FUNCTION OF AC-GLOBULIN AND LIPID IN BLOOD CLOTTING.
In this kinetic study of prothrombin activation prothrombin, thrombin, autoprothrombin C, autoprothrombin I, and Ac-globulin were used in purified form. The lipids used were protein-free sedimentable brain thromboplastin and crude "cephalin". Ac-globulin changed the substrate specificity of autoprothrombin C so that the latter really functions quite as another enzyme designated autoprothrombin C-AcG. The enzyme specificity of thrombin was also changed with Ac-globulin. The modified enzyme is designated thrombin-AcG. The two enzymes from prothrombin function in autocatalysis, and Ac-globulin is a co-autocatalyst. Thrombin-AcG is relatively a weaker enzyme than autoprothrombin C-AcG. With brain thromboplastin and Ac-globulin the two activation products are thrombin and autoprothrombin C. If the two procoagulants, brain thromboplastin and Ac-globulin, are in low concentration, autoprothrombin I compensates for the deficiency.
